Vimanas are ancient Indian flying machines mentioned in many ancient Sanskrit texts, including the Vedas, the Mahabharata, and the Ramayana. These texts describe vimanas in great detail, including their appearance, construction, and operation.

One of the most comprehensive texts on vimanas is the Vaimanika Shastra, a Sanskrit manuscript written by Maharishi Bharadwaja in the 4th century BC. The Vaimanika Shastra describes 76 different types of vimanas, ranging in size from small one-man craft to large airships capable of carrying hundreds of passengers.

According to the Vaimanika Shastra, vimanas were powered by a variety of methods, including solar energy, mercury engines, and anti-gravity devices. They were also equipped with advanced navigational and communication systems.

Vimanas were used for a variety of purposes, including transportation, warfare, and exploration. Ancient Indian texts describe vimanas being used to travel long distances quickly and easily, to wage war against enemies, and to explore the cosmos.
